_“In late January, we announced that Bridgefield Capital signed an agreement to acquire Philips’ Emergency Care business which includes leading brands and products like HeartStart AEDs, Intrepid and DFM100 monitor defibrillators, Tempus monitor and Tempus ALS systems, and Corsium and ECI informatics solutions. We expect the transaction to close at the end of 2025._ _With Bridgefield’s support and building on our 40+ year legacy of growth and innovation in emergency medical technology, the Emergency Care business will continue passionately pursuing our mission of saving lives, lowering the cost of healthcare, and advancing the science of resuscitation while serving the public access AED, EMS, military, and hospital market segments.”_ Philips Emergency Care is seeking a dynamic and experienced Software Test Manager to lead our talented team of test engineers in delivering cutting-edge Informatics solutions.
